Calculus I FAQ

What are the basics I should know before starting Calculus I?

Before starting Calculus I, you should be comfortable with algebraic manipulation, understand the properties of exponents and logarithms, have a good grasp of trigonometry and geometry, and be familiar with the concepts of functions and their graphs. These pre-calculus skills are crucial for understanding limits, derivatives, and integrals, which are the core topics of Calculus I.

How do I find the limit of a function as x approaches a value?

To find the limit of a function as x approaches a particular value, you can substitute the value into the function if the function is continuous at that point. If there is a discontinuity, you may need to use algebraic techniques to simplify the function or apply L'Hôpital's rule if the limit forms an indeterminate form like 0/0 or ∞/∞. Graphical or numerical methods can also provide insight into the behavior of the function near the value.

What is the derivative of a function, and how do I calculate it?

The derivative of a function represents the rate of change of the function with respect to a variable, often time or space. To calculate the derivative, you can use the definition of a derivative as the limit of a difference quotient, or more commonly, apply differentiation rules such as the power rule, product rule, quotient rule, and chain rule. The derivative at a point gives the slope of the tangent line to the function's graph at that point.

How can I determine the maximum or minimum of a function using Calculus I?

To determine the maximum or minimum of a function using Calculus I techniques, you first find its derivative to identify critical points where the derivative is zero or undefined. Then, by checking the sign of the derivative before and after these points, or using the second derivative test, you can determine if these critical points are local maxima, minima, or points of inflection. Absolute maximum and minimum values can be found by evaluating the function at critical points and endpoints in a closed interval.

What is integral calculus, and how do I perform basic integrations?

Integral calculus is concerned with finding the function, known as the antiderivative or integral, that would differentiate to give a given function. This process involves finding the area under the curve of a graphed function over an interval. To perform basic integrations, you can use antiderivative rules that are the reverse of differentiation rules, such as the power rule for integration, and add the constant of integration. Techniques like substitution and integration by parts are also used for more complex functions.

About Howardwick, TX And It’s Education Institutions

Howardwick, Texas, a quaint city located in Donley County, boasts a history that ties closely to the development of the surrounding Panhandle region. Founded in the latter half of the 20th century, specifically in 1963, Howardwick serves as a serene residence for those looking to escape the hustle and bustle of larger Texas cities. As of the most recent data, this small community has a population that hovers around a modest 400 inhabitants, illustrating its tight-knit nature. While Howardwick may not have a plethora of landmarks, one significant point of interest is Greenbelt Reservoir, a nearby body of water that offers recreational activities, including fishing, boating, and nature appreciation, making it a focal point for both residents and visitors.

When it comes to educational institutions, Howardwick does not have its own school district; however, the city falls under the jurisdiction of the Clarendon Independent School District (CISD), which serves the educational needs of the region's youth. While Howardwick itself may not boast top-ranking K-12 schools within city limits, the nearby Clarendon ISD provides public schooling options for residents, and children from the city typically attend schools in Clarendon. Regarding educational resources, local students have access to various programs and facilities provided by the district, which are designed to enhance educational experiences, promote academic excellence, and support individual growth.

Unfortunately, there are no universities directly in Howardwick, and the closest higher education institutions are located in some of the larger neighboring cities. Students seeking a college education may look to institutions in the broader Panhandle area. These schools range from community colleges to larger universities, offering a diverse array of programs to suit different interests and career paths. The proximity of these institutions ensures that residents of Howardwick, both young and old, have access to further education and lifelong learning opportunities, despite the rural setting of their hometown.

About Calculus I & Calculus I Tutoring

Calculus I, an introductory branch of mathematics, is fundamentally the study of change, which provides a framework for modeling systems in which there is change, and a way to deduce the predictions of such models. It is divided into two key areas: differential calculus, which focuses on the concept of the derivative, and integral calculus, which focuses on the concept of the integral.

Differential calculus involves the calculation of the derivative, which measures how a function changes as its input changes. Essentially, the derivative is the rate of change or slope of the curve of the function at a certain point. Understanding derivatives is crucial for solving problems in physics, engineering, economics, and beyond.

Integral calculus, on the other hand, involves the calculation of the integral, which can be thought of as the accumulation of quantities and the area under or between curves. This concept is widely applicable; for example, it's used to calculate areas, volumes, and the total accumulated change from a rate of change.

Calculus I typically covers topics including limits, the derivative, differentiation techniques, applications of the derivative, the definite integral, the indefinite integral, and the fundamental theorem of calculus, which links differentiation with integration.

Related entities to Calculus I include precalculus topics such as algebra, trigonometry, and analytic geometry, as they lay the groundwork for calculus by providing a firm grasp of functions and their properties. Physics is highly interconnected with calculus since physical changes and phenomena are described and analyzed using calculus principles.

Tutoring someone who struggles with Calculus I should involve personalized strategies tailored to their unique challenges. A strong foundation in precalculus is vital, so it's wise to ensure those skills are secure before progressing. Also, using real-world applications can help to illustrate the concepts, making them more tangible and easier to grasp. Incremental learning with plenty of practice problems, immediate feedback, and an emphasis on conceptual understanding over memorization are key components of an effective teaching strategy.

The most common concepts in Calculus I are limits, derivatives of functions, applications of the derivative such as optimization and related rates, and basic integration. Students often struggle with the abstract nature of limits, the rules of differentiation, understanding the graphical interpretation of derivatives, and the techniques and application of integration.

In conclusion, Calculus I is an essential foundation for many fields that require an understanding of dynamic systems. Success in this subject is predicated on a strong grasp of precalculus, a conceptual understanding of change, and practiced skills in differentiation and integration. Effective tutoring for those struggling with calculus often involves making these abstract concepts concrete and building from the ground up with plenty of real-world applications and practice.
